    I was not surprised in the least to discover that someone from Lost worked on Arcane. The episodic structure is *extremely* similar, the way that each episode opens with a different character's backstory, which is used to frame the story from that character's perspective and sometimes recontextualize a character's behavior in a more charitable light. Think of how nearly everyone perceives Mel as being coldly manipulative and self-serving up until we meet her mother, or how Silco's flashback explains his unexpected decision to take in Powder at the climax of that episode.
